In general, drives have parameter sets to adjust behaviour in such cases: position recovery, adaptation with resistant torque, out-of-position window failure, etc. (Much depends on the type of configuration set for the axis: positioner, speed controller, torque controller, etc.). I have used that type of drive very little, in only two cases and a long time ago. To tell you what is normal is impossible. I know by reputation they are very simple objects, without too many pretensions and adjustments possible. Try running traces by monitoring actual position, motor current, torque and following error. These are the most sensible curves to understand what is going on. Maybe by fine tuning the motor tuning, the current controller or the speed controller you will get something closer to what you want. For example, from DS, the motor has a standstill torque of 3 Nm. Observe with traces whether this is effective: motor current trend. And afterwards, when you have your own accurate picture of the situation, you can also hear from the product's local support to see if you can steal a few more things from it performance-wise.

Wie gesagt ich hatte noch keinen Kontakt mit SNMP. Um die Beispiele zu verstehen hier ein paar Tips: SetEngineId und CreateSNMPV3User sind Funktionsbausteine. Klicke rechts auf den Namen, Symbol suchen - Gehe zu Definition Dann sieht du entweder den Quelltext oder landest in der Bibliothek und kannst dir die Dokumentation ansehen. In deinen Fall siehst du den Quelltext. Die Funktionsbausteine sind in den Projekt POUs gespeichert weil das Projekt aus mehreren Applikationen besteht die alle diese FBs nutzen. sOID (drei Balken)oid → was wird da gemacht? In die Stringvariable sOID (String old ID?) wird der Inhalt von oid geschrieben. oid ist Member der Strukturvariable snmpVarBindings. Dem SNMP_SET Aufruf wird snmpVarBindings übergeben und geändert. Und da müsste doch irgendwo eine Verschlüsselung eingetragen werden oder? Beim Anlegen der SMNP-User wird ein Passwort vergeben, siehe CreateSNMPV3User. Dem SNMP_SET Aufruf wird nur der User übergeben, hier "readwrite". Die Bibliothek sucht sich die Einstellung des Users selbst.

Is it possible to transmit a PDU1 PGN using the J1939 manager and local device? What if I need to transmit a PGN RQST via 0xEA00 (PGN 59904)? How would I do this P2P (Destination < 0xFF) or broadcast (Destination 0xFF)? I don't think this is possible for any destination type. I don't think it's possible to receive broadcast PDU1 messages either. For example, an address claim PGN 60928 (0x18EEFF80) is addressed to all nodes (0xFF) and not any specific local device so it will be filtered out. These are major oversights in the IoDrvJ1939 library to not support every PDU1 RX/TX scenario. IoDrvJ1939 supported scenario: 1. Receive (RX) PDU1 (P2P) destination-specific (PDU-specific < 255) to local device with matching address IoDrvJ1939 unsupported scenarios: 1. Receive (RX) PDU1 (P2P) global (PDU-specific = 255) 2. Transmit (TX) PDU1 (P2P) global (PDU-specific = 255) 3. Transmit (TX) PDU1 (P2P) destination-specific (PDU-specific < 255)
